 mysql-dfsg-5.0 (5.0.32-7etch5) stable-security; urgency=high
 .
   * SECURITY:
     Fix for CVE-2008-0226 and CVE-2008-0227: Three vulnerabilities in yaSSL
     versions 1.7.5 and earlier were discovered that could lead to a server
     crash or execution of unauthorized code. The exploit requires a server
     with yaSSL enabled and TCP/IP connections enabled, but does not require
     valid MySQL account credentials. The exploit does not apply to OpenSSL.
     (closes: #460873)
 .
 mysql-dfsg-5.0 (5.0.32-7etch4) stable-security; urgency=high
 .
   * SECURITY:
     Fix for CVE-2007-3781: CREATE TABLE LIKE did not require any privileges on
     the source table. Now it requires the SELECT privilege.
   * SECURITY:
     Fix for CVE-2007-5969: Using RENAME TABLE against a table with explicit
     DATA DIRECTORY and INDEX DIRECTORY options can be used to overwrite system
     table information by replacing the file to which the symlink points.
     (closes: #455010)
   * SECURITY:
     Fix for CVE-2007-6304: When using a FEDERATED table, the local server can
     be forced to crash if the remote server returns a result with fewer columns
     than expected. (closes: #455737)
